AN ACT to amend the environmental conservation law, in relation to
permitting municipalities to grant exceptions to air pollution control
requirements
TH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M-
B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. Section 19-0709 of the environmental conservation law is
amended to read as follows:
S 19-0709. Local laws, ordinances and regulations.
1. Any local laws, ordinances or regulations of any governing body of
a county, city, town or village which are not inconsistent with this
article or with any code, rule or regulation which shall be promulgated
pursuant to this article shall not be superseded by it, and nothing in
this article or in any code, rule or regulation which shall be promul-
gated pursuant to this article shall preclude the right of any governing
body of a county, city, town or village to adopt local laws, ordinances
or regulations which are not inconsistent with this article or with any
code, rule or regulation which shall be promulgated pursuant to this
article provided, however, that the exercise of such right by a county
shall relate only to the area thereof outside any city, village or area
of any town outside the village or villages therein during such time as
such city, village or town has local laws, ordinances or regulations
consistent with this article or with any code, rule or regulation which
shall be promulgated pursuant to this article. [Any] EXCEPT AS OTHERWISE
PROVIDED IN SUBDIVISION TWO OF THIS SECTION, ANY local laws, ordinances
or regulations of a county, city, town or village which comply with at
least the minimum applicable requirements set forth in any code, rule or
regulation promulgated pursuant to this article shall be deemed consist-
ent with this article or with any such code, rule or regulation.

2. A COUNTY, CITY, TOWN OR VILLAGE MAY PERMIT EXCEPTIONS TO ANY CODE,
RULE OR REGULATION PROMULGATED PURSUANT TO THIS ARTICLE UPON APPLICATION
BY A RESIDENT ONLY AFTER COMPLETION OF AN ON-SITE INSPECTION.
S 2. This act shall take effect immediately.
